Two Axis DC MEMS Accelerometer Transducer for Vibration Measurement

Product Description

Two Axis DC MEMS Accelerometer Transducer for Vibration Measurement



FEATURES:


Differential capacitance working principle
Wide frequency range from DC to 400Hz
Stable performance
Convenient in use
